IUPAC: Poly(2-hydroxypropanoic acid)
CAS: 26100-51-6
개요
PLA is a biodegradable polymer made from corn starch or sugarcane. It is the most widely used bioplastic, found in 3D printing filament and compostable packaging.

용도
- • 3D printing filament
- • Compostable food packaging
- • Medical implants (absorbable sutures)
- • Textile fiber

성질
- 유형
- polymer
- 상태
- solid
- 몰 질량
- 72.06 g/mol
- 밀도
- 1.2100 g/cm³
- 녹는점
- 157.0 °C
- 용해도
- insoluble
